Low Engine Coolant Indicator Always On

Circuit/System Description

The low engine coolant level indicator is controlled by the HVAC control module. The normal state of the engine coolant level switch is closed when in contact with coolant.

Circuit/System Verification

The low coolant indicator should be OFF with the engine coolant at the proper level.


Circuit/System Testing

Important: Circuit/System Verification must be performed before performing the Circuit/System Testing.



1. Ignition OFF, disconnect the harness connector at the coolant level switch.
2. Install a 3A fused jumper wire between the signal circuit terminal and ground.
3. Engine running, verify the low coolant indicator turns OFF.

If the indicator does not turn OFF, test the signal circuit for an open/high resistance.
If the indicator turns OFF, test the ground circuit for an open/high resistance.

4. If all circuits test normal, replace the coolant level switch.
